Contract Lead
Responsibilities:
Participate in pre-qualification and contractor selection
Liaise with Procurement to ensure required Contract Documents are in place
Participate in contract handover between Procurement and Business Line
Initiate and facilitate contract kick-off meeting with Contractor
Communicate with Contractor to develop a joint Interface Management Plan
Engage in the contract life cycle and oversee the entire contract portfolio for each business line/function
Responsible for stewarding contractor interface activities throughout the contract life cycle
Participate in service planning and develop contract strategy
Act as a liaison and coordinator among Procurement, SSH&E, and Operations within the business line
Establish and maintain the Active Contractor Tracking Database
Monthly KPI reporting (e.g., Contract Stewardship, Man-hour reporting, etc.)
Link to other business lines to share best practices
Coordinate and conduct Contractor Site Assessments
Coordinate review of contractor crew competency
Organize and coordinate Contractor Performance Assessments (Reporting Quarterly interface, A&Dcompliance, Contractor compliance check and Annual Performance Scorecard) Report Contractor performance to OI 8-1 System Owner and Administrator
Coordinate and facilitate Level 2 and 3 quarterly, annual performance review/feedback meetings
Liaise with SSH&E Team to schedule Level 4 SSHE Sharing Meeting
Assist with coordinating Level 5 Annual Contractor Safety Forum
Assist Contract Owner in performing suspension and/or termination of contracts
Initiate and ensure contract completion and close out with contractor
